Gennady Kulabukhov
Verified Expert in Engineering
Software Developer
Belgorod, Belgorod Oblast, Russia
Toptal member since April 18, 2019
Gennady is a software engineer with more than seven years of experience in mobile applications development with strong knowledge of the Android framework. During his career, he has delivered many applications to the Google Play store. Also, he's experienced in team management and teaching.
Portfolio
Experience
Availability
Preferred Environment
Git, Android Studio, MacOS
The most amazing...
...thing I've built is a scalable mobile app that integrates many different fitness trackers with different protocols and cover them with a unified interface.
Work Experience
Individual Entrepreneur
Individual Entrepreneur
- Led a development team (Android and iOS developers).
- Designed applications architecture conforming to project requirements.
- Helped team members in the development and technical progression.
- Developed and launched the "Run Races" project (Android, iOS, back end) which helps runners to find races all over the world to participate in.
Part-time Lecturer
Belgorod State Technological University
- Taught a course “Architecture and programming for mobile devices."
Senior Android Developer
Kaerus, LLC
- Developed Android applications for several client-server products.
- Led a small development team (Android and iOS developers).
- Communicated with other development teams and clients.
Mobile Developer
Geolocation Technology, CSJC
- Developed an Android client from scratch and took part in the development of an iOS client for dating service gotyou.ru.
- Took part in development of several internal projects.
Junior Mobile Developer
Factory of Information Technologies, LLC
- Developed several Android and iOS applications for company products and services.
- Studied for new technologies and software development process and tools.
- Developed and released first version of Android application for 2do2go.ru portal (events and places aggregator).
Experience
My JetSport
https://play.google.com/store/apps/details?id=com.elegion.jet.sportMy JetKid
https://play.google.com/store/apps/details?id=com.elegion.jet.kidRun Races
Mobile Doctor
Mobile Agent
Completed product testing, competitive analysis, mystery shopper, gathering information, and opinion polls.
Education
Specialist of Engineering Degree in Software Engineering
Belgorod Shukhov State Technological University - Belgorod, Russia
Skills
Libraries/APIs
RxJava 2, Retrofit
Tools
Git, Android Studio, Jira
Languages
Kotlin, Java, Objective-C, Swift
Frameworks
Android SDK, Dagger 2
Paradigms
Object-oriented Programming (OOP), Model View Presenter (MVP), Agile Software Development, REST
Platforms
Android, MacOS, iOS, Firebase
Other
Leadership
How to Work with Toptal
Toptal matches you directly with global industry experts from our network in hours—not weeks or months.
Share your needs
Choose your talent
Start your risk-free talent trial
Top talent is in high demand.
Start hiring